Kisses - People Can Do The Most Amazing Things

Label: This Is Music
Released: 3rd August 2010
Reviewer: Linda Aust
A band called Kisses? With a single called ‘People Can Do The Most Amazing Things’? Sounds like a right load of shiny happy hippie crap, non? Well to be perfectly honest Kisses are on the verge of sounding like Fleetwood Mac (gross) with Phil Collins on vocal duties singing ‘The Streets of Philadelphia’ (worrying) which equates to some sort of lofty Europop 80s power ballad (what?).

However, in their defence one has to admit that this little low-profile release grows on you after a few listens with its underdog charm. It’s all tinkly melodies and the song itself has a dreamy quality with Jesse Kivel’s (of Princeton fame) crooning voice. It’s a chilled out positively harrowing slow-burning summer anthem.

‘People Can Do The Most Amazing Things’ is in equal parts sleek and simmering 80s electro twinned with Saint Etienne like power keyboards and lyrical geek-pop. In the shelf this would sit under chillwave. Some people might like that.
Rating: 6/10
